Thanks Narelle and enjoy your travels! That's great that you plan to add more to WIkiTree, it's a great place to work. Just be aware that WikiTree is pretty strict on the requitement to add a reliable source to pre-1700 profiles at the time they're created. So when you create any more pre-1700 profiles just bear that in mind. Other online trees do not count as a reliable source but something like a baptism or marriage record is great. For post 1700 profiles it's more acceptable to put in the outline and then add more info later, although it's always good practice to add a reliable source at creation if possible.
